> Tomas Fulajtar wrote:
> > 
> > Hello,
> > I'am  using MSAccess 97 with Postgres 7.0x as
> > backend. ODBC driver parameter <Recognize unique
> > indexes> is set to on. When i link table as an ODBC,
> > access manager ask me for unique index for each table.
> > Why don't it recognize my table's primary or foreign keys
> > ? I must set this manualy. I want to link table in VBA
> > code dynamicaly, but for this reason it is impossible
> > (when i do'nt set any field as index, i can't update any
> > table). What solution is for it?
> > 
> 
> Which version of psqlodbc driver are you using ?
> 
> regards,
> Hiroshi Inoue
> 
I solved this problem by upgrading driver to version 
7.01.0004. Everything is ok now, each index is 
recognized correctly. Only when I link tables without any 
unique index i must set index manually to oid.
